Before archiving a cold storage bucket in Glacierette, detach all plugin hooks. Run the freeze job, confirm checksum parity, then revoke scoped tokens. Do not delete manifests; the Vexhall recovery service reads them during account restoration. If the bucket owner's account is locked, trigger the recovery flow from the Opsgate console, not the plugin API. Archival completes within 20 minutes. Plugins must tolerate 404s on frozen objects. To unseal the restore job, use the passphrase below.

vault phrase of fawig-yagug = tamix-norys-ulaix-joreth-druius-jorael-briax-prair-lamael-caseth-brivan-lamius-istius

## Read-Replica Lag Alarm

New folks: the ReplicaLagHigh alarm covers the Ostrel reporting replicas. It fires when lag exceeds 90 seconds for five minutes. Most triggers come from the nightly Bramwell export job, which is expected and auto-resolves. Do not fail over the replica yourself — that requires the data-platform lead's approval and a change ticket. If the alarm persists past 20 minutes with no export running, write to the platform inbox.

billing contact of yahip-yadup = eliax.druix@zemvarworks.corp

HANDOVER NOTE — Hermetic build migration (Cobbleforge)

To the support team: I'm handing the Cobbleforge migration to Daro mid-stream. We've moved roughly 60% of targets from the old shell-based build into the hermetic Anvilux sandbox; the remaining targets still fetch dependencies at build time and will fail behind the sealed network policy. If users report nondeterministic artifacts, check whether their target is on the migrated list first. The Anvilux cache admin account unlocks with the recovery passphrase below.

recovery phrase for bawif-yawif: gorwyn-kelix-zorox-silath-novix-juleth

## Further Reading

Duskrunner schedules nightly backfills at 02:30 local cluster time. Support tickets about missing partitions almost always trace back to a skipped run, not data loss. Check the run ledger first, then the retry queue. Escalate only if both look clean. The full triage flowchart and ledger guide are kept on the internal page linked below.

operations page: https://jira.lumiclabs.internal/pages/display/projects/af69ce92